IMPALA-11265: Part2: Store Iceberg file descriptors in encoded format

The file descriptors in HdfsPartition are cached as byte arrays to keep
the memory footprint low. They are transformed into actual
FileDescriptor objects once queried.
This patch changes IcebergContentFileStore to similarly use byte arrays
as an internal representation for file descriptors. Note, file
descriptors for Iceberg tables have 2 components: one is the same as in
HdfsPartition and the other stores Iceberg specific file metadata in an
additional byte array.

Measurements and observations:
 - I have a test table that has 110k data files. For this table the JVM
   memory usage in the catalogd got reduced from 80MB to 65MB.
 - Both HdfsPartition.FileDescriptor and IcebergContentFileStore use
   flatbuffers and in turn byte arrays to represent file descriptors and
   these byte arrays are shared between these 2 places. As a result
   there is no redundancy in storing the file descriptors both for the
   Iceberg and the Hdfs table.
 - There is no measurable difference in planning times with this patch.

> During the investigation of IMPALA-11260, I found the cache item size of a 
> (IcebergApiTableCacheKey, org.apache.iceberg.BaseTable) pair could be 30MB.
> For instance, here are the cache items of the iceberg table 
> {{{}functional_parquet.iceberg_partitioned{}}}:

> Note that this table just have 20 rows. The total memory footprint size is 
> 30MB.
> For a normal partitioned partquet table, the memory footprint is not that 
> large. For instance, here are the cache items for 
> {{{}functional_parquet.alltypes{}}}:

> The total size is around 45KB.
> It worths double checking whether we need the whole 
> org.apache.iceberg.BaseTable object. Maybe we can just extract what Impala 
> needs into a custom value class.
> CC [~boroknagyz] 
> *Update:*
> I'm not sure how that measurement was performed, but I don't think that the 
> difference of table types comes from the BaseTable object, but from the way 
> we store them. Most importantly how we store file descriptors. I've made 
> measurement on the catalogd and also on the coordinator in local-catalog 
> mode. You can find the numbers in this doc:
